  • It isn't the blower motor. My TJ is doing the same thing,but I'm living with it. If you take the switch panel out and disassemble the switch it's self, the switch operates by a ball bearing rolling over different contacts. Horrible design, ahha! A new switch panel should cost about 60$ on Ebay.

  • did you ever fix the problem? mine is doing the exact same thing and I'm not sure if its the switch or the blower motor resistor

  • @calrain07 Yes, it is the Blower Motor Resister, I got it at Autozone for like 12.99 theres lot of DIY instructions around that are super detailed on replacement.
